8 - 04 Momentary Power Loss Operation Selection Factory Setting: d 0
Settings d 0 Operation stop after momentary power loss
d 1 Operation continue after momentary power loss
Speed search start with the Master Frequency reference
value
d 2 Operation continue after momentary power loss
Speed search start with the min frequency

8 - 06 Base-Block Time for Speed Search Factory Setting: d 0.5
Settings d 0.3 to d 5.0Sec Unit: 0.1Sec
! When a momentary power loss is detected, the AC drive turns off for a specified time
interval determined by Pr.8-06 before resuming operation. This time interval is called
Base-Block. This parameter should be set to a value where the residual output voltage
is nearly zero, before the drive resumes operation.
! This parameter also determines the searching time when performing external Base-Block
and fault reset.
